This continues our work to follow the dependency inversion style for the
"package fetcher" component of the module installer.
Mimicking the existing pattern for providers, package main is now
responsible for instantiating the PackageFetcher and providing it to
the "command" package as a field of command.Meta.
We could potentially go further here and follow dependency inversion style
for _all_ of the special clients needed by the various go-getter getters,
but our primary concern for now is preparing to add a new "getter" for
installation from an OCI Distribution repository, and so we'll leave the
other already-working code unchanged to reduce the risk of this initial
work.
Future commits will actually wire in the implementation details for OCI
Repository access. This commit focuses only on plumbing the necessary
objects through the API layers.
